Movies of Gordon De Main and Robert Frazer together

Gordon De Main and Robert Frazer have starred in 8 movies together. Their first film was Arm of the Law in 1932. The most recent movie that Gordon De Main and Robert Frazer starred together was Desert Command in 1946.
